Shirin Sha needs nothing more than a white sheet of paper to beam us into another world.

Anyone who has underestimated the beauty and ingenuity of paper so far will be proven wrong by the artist Anja Shahinniya aka Shirin Sha. Paper is – at least when it has slipped through the German’s gluttonous precision scissors – the raw material for dreams made of art. The Munich artist conjures up entire spring landscapes, miniature cities or mythical creatures that are elfin and detailed down to the smallest detail. A cheer for 275 grams of embossed white paper – that is the artist’s favourite material.
